Manawatu Herald SATURDAY, MARCH 3, 1928. THE HEMP INDUSTRY.
THE application of scientific methods in the production of hemp promises to revolutionise and revive an important national industry which gave evidence of languishing. Credit'is due to the activities of the Scientific Industrial Research Board for its experimental work and the success it has already accomplished in the application of scientific methods of bleaching and cultivation which has inspired millers with fresh hope and a spirit of co-operation. The industry in tlie past lias been dominated by individualism rather than cohesion. The man upon whose land the flax grows fixes his royalty and cutting rights, and the miller in producing the hemp is sandwiched between the royalty impositions and the industrial side and in the circumstances has felt little inclination for experimental work. The Government offered a bonus for improved methods of production, but has now gone a step further by banging the industry within the scope of the Scientific Industrial Research Board with promising and farreaching results. The work of the Seifert family in their endeavours to promote the welfare of the industry cannot be overlooked and much is due to their sustained activities. While attention is being given to the finished article, more must be done to promote the cultivation of the green blade and to place a proportionate share of financial responsibility upon the grower. This is a phase of the industry which may require further Government co-operation and legislation. In the meantime it is pleasing to note that the millers have signified their willingness ,to financially assist the' Scientific Research Board in their operations to raise the standard of the industry and so assist out national exports.
